Description

Large and light three bedroom apartment, delivered over two floors and 1168 square feet, with its own generous rear garden (of over 50 feet, and which faces east with a twist of south) with direct access from the property and side access as well. A share of the building's Freehold seals the deal.

The pleasing pad has been extensively and tastefully renovated by the current owners - beautifully and sensitively blending period features with modern upgrades and built-in storage. You'll not need to lift a finger!

Laid over the two lower floors - with your entrance at raised ground floor level - your new home is one of just two flats within a tall, flat-fronted Victorian townie on one of Brockley Conservation Area's principal streets; the top part of which connects with gorgeous Hilly Fields.

Parking is currently unrestricted on this and neighbouring streets. Walk just a few minutes to St Johns Station (eight minutes to London Bridge), and 15 to Brockley Station (with Overground in addition to regular rail services). And Brockley Market - a fun foodie affair which runs on Saturdays 10am-2pm - is but a three minute walk from your door.

You share a main front door and hall with one other property above yours. Your own front door sits to your left from the neat hall. Straight ahead here and you'll find your supersized reception room to the front of the building. This is over 18 feet by over 13 feet, with cool custom-made storage (in the form of both shelving and cupboards), and stripped wooden floorboards which flow through to the large kitchen - which is over 13 feet by over 12 feet. This has has a smart central island/breakfast bar and lovely exposed brick detail.

Down the hall and a couple of stairs (stripped boards continuing to impress) and you'll find your back door out to the garden. This is a private and mature affair with lawned and paved areas, and with a shed that's staying.

Next you have a cute (windowed) guest w.c. before you get to your bedroom and bathroom floor.

This floor hosts three bedrooms - all are large doubles. The ones to the front are over 13 feet by over 8 feet and over 13 feet by over 9 feet (both have sash windows). Your third bedroom is over 13 feet by over 12 feet, with built-in floor-to-ceiling wardrobes to the alcoves. Completing the tour, you have a full (windowed) bathroom with both bath and independent shower, and traditional-style sanitary ware and fittings.

We've mentioned your two closest stations. It is also an easy walk to New Cross, Lewisham and Deptford DLR stations. You're well-placed for buses as well - with Lewisham Way at the foot of the street.

This is such a pretty, leafy, well-connected spot. You have a Brockley postcode (SE4) but you're close to SE8, SE14 and SE13: you can enjoy all four therefore.

The Talbot pub is a popular and well-run local (their roast dinners and tacos particularly impress). Middleton coffee shop is a good tip for fantastic coffee, pastries, brunches and sourdough loaves). Meze Mangal (restaurant) and Kalimar (cafe) on Lewisham Way are also lovely.

Brockley has strong independent restaurants such as Mauby, Ellary's and L'Oculto Cocina, and cocktail bars: Brickfields, Joyce, and you've got Brockley Brewery of course.

The Deptford High Street area - including Deptford Market Yard - is super trendy, with bars, night spots, cafes, restaurants and breweries. We particularly rate Marcella, The Watergate, Jars Bar and Yuzu. Deli X is nice for fresh loaves, simple lunches, coffee and posh deli items.

Central New Cross is close, with Goldsmiths Uni and Goldsmiths CCA (contemporary art gallery, open to the public) plus nice pubs like The Rose Inn and The Amersham Arms.

Central Lewisham is handily close (just over half a mile) for mall shopping and markets and Glass Mill Leisure Centre (there is a monthly Sunday market here too).

Green space? Stroll to Hilly Fields in seven minutes, or walk about half an hour for Greenwich Royal Park. You're also close to lovely Ladywell Fields.
